“ChatGPT提示inittimeout”错误的解决方案与优化策略
什么是“ChatGPT提示inittimeout”错误?
近年来,ChatGPT作为人工智能技术的代表,已经广泛应用于各种场景,包括智能客服、语言生成、创意写作、教育辅导等。尽管技术已经相对成熟,一些用户在使用过程中仍然会遇到类似“ChatGPT提示inittimeout”这样的错误提示。这种错误提示往往会让用户困惑:为什么会发生这种情况?是否是系统故障?该如何处理?

“inittimeout”错误是一个典型的超时错误,通常与系统初始化过程中的超时设置有关。简单来说,ChatGPT在进行用户请求时,需要连接到其云服务器进行处理和响应。若连接请求的初始化过程超过了规定的时间限制,就会触发“inittimeout”错误。对于开发者而言,这意味着连接超时,无法在预定的时间内完成与服务器的交互;而对于普通用户来说,这意味着无法及时获得想要的回复或服务。

“inittimeout”错误的常见原因
网络连接不稳定
最常见的原因之一就是用户的网络连接不稳定。在使用ChatGPT的过程中,尤其是当网络信号较弱或带宽不足时,连接到云服务器的请求可能会超时。特别是在使用移动设备或公共Wi-Fi网络时,连接的不稳定性会加剧此类问题。

服务器负载过高
在高峰时段,尤其是当大量用户同时使用ChatGPT服务时,服务器的处理能力可能会达到极限,导致响应变慢甚至超时。此时,服务器无法在规定的时间内完成初始化,从而触发inittimeout错误。
API调用次数超限
对于使用ChatGPTAPI的开发者来说,调用次数超过了API的限制也可能导致该错误。例如,某个API密钥的调用频次超出了系统预定的上限,导致初始化过程无法完成。
系统故障或配置问题
在少数情况下,系统故障或者配置问题也可能导致“inittimeout”错误。比如,服务器出现硬件故障、程序出现bug、或者防火墙等安全设置导致连接被阻断,都可能导致请求超时。
聊天框架的集成问题
对于一些通过第三方框架集成ChatGPT的应用程序,框架本身的问题或配置不当也可能导致初始化超时。特别是当开发者对API调用进行频繁操作时,过多的请求可能导致超时。
如何快速排查“inittimeout”错误?
面对“ChatGPT提示inittimeout”的错误,用户首先要做的是了解问题的来源,逐一排查可能的原因。以下是几种有效的排查方法:
检查网络连接
确保网络连接稳定。你可以尝试通过浏览器访问其他网站来确认网络状态,或者切换到更稳定的网络环境(如Wi-Fi或有线网络)以提高连接的质量。
监测服务器状态
如果你是开发者,或许可以通过查看ChatGPT服务提供商的状态页面来检查是否有服务器故障或高负载的情况。一般来说,服务商会定期发布系统维护通知或故障报告,帮助用户了解当前的服务状况。
减少API调用频率
对于使用API的开发者,确保你的请求频率没有超出限制。你可以查看API文档,了解调用次数和时间间隔的具体规定,必要时调整调用频率,避免因请求过于频繁导致超时。
调试第三方集成
如果你通过第三方集成框架使用ChatGPT,可以查看该框架的调试日志,确认是否存在配置问题或其他错误。某些集成框架可能会有默认的超时设置,导致初始化过程失败。
重试请求
有时网络波动或服务器短时间的过载会导致请求超时,此时可以尝试稍后重试。如果错误不是持续性的,重试几次可能就能恢复正常。
“inittimeout”错误的解决方案
针对上述原因,解决“ChatGPT提示inittimeout”错误的方法也有所不同。我们将针对不同的情况提供一些具体的解决方案,帮助用户恢复流畅的使用体验。
解决方案一:优化网络环境
如果问题源自网络连接不稳定,优化网络环境是最直接有效的解决方法。你可以尝试以下几种方式来改善网络连接:
切换到更稳定的网络
如果你在使用移动数据网络或公共Wi-Fi时遇到问题,可以切换到更稳定的私人Wi-Fi或有线网络,确保更高的网络带宽和更低的延迟。
使用网络加速工具
对于部分用户来说,网络加速工具可能有助于提高与服务器的连接速度。你可以尝试使用VPN或专用网络加速服务,选择更适合访问目标服务器的网络路径。
解决方案二:提升API调用效率
对于开发者而言,优化API调用效率是减少超时错误的重要步骤。你可以考虑以下优化方法:
合理安排请求频率
确保你的请求频率符合API的使用规范,避免一次性发送过多请求。你可以通过引入请求队列机制,避免并发请求过高导致超时。
使用异步请求
如果API支持异步调用,可以使用异步请求来优化系统的响应速度,减少由于同步等待导致的超时问题。
解决方案三:等待服务器恢复
如果问题是由于服务器负载过高或系统故障导致的,你可以尝试等待一段时间,再次尝试请求。对于服务商而言,解决高负载问题通常需要一些时间,因此耐心等待是一个有效的解决方案。
解决方案四:调整超时设置
一些开发者在集成ChatGPT时,可能会遇到“inittimeout”错误。这时,调整超时设置可能是一种解决方案。如果你在代码中有权限修改API请求的超时时间,可以尝试将超时时间设置为更长,以适应可能的网络波动或服务器响应延迟。
解决方案五:联系客服或技术支持
如果尝试了以上方法后,仍然无法解决问题,那么联系ChatGPT的技术支持团队可能是最好的选择。服务商通常会提供详细的故障排查支持,帮助你快速解决问题。
总结
“ChatGPT提示inittimeout”错误虽然给用户带来一定的不便,但通过科学的排查方法和针对性的解决方案,问题是可以有效解决的。无论是优化网络环境、调整API调用频率,还是等待服务器恢复,都是应对该错误的有效手段。对于开发者而言,通过优化代码和提高请求效率,也可以大幅减少这种错误的发生。
希望本文为你提供了有价值的信息,并帮助你顺利解决“inittimeout”错误,让ChatGPT的使用体验更加流畅。如果你是开发者,不妨将这些优化建议应用到项目中,提高系统的稳定性和响应速度;如果你是普通用户,也可以尝试根据本文的建议进行操作,快速恢复正常使用。